When dining anywhere in the Sunshine State, it's hard to avoid tourist clip joints, especially where Jeannie resides, Cocoa Beach, FL. And so it was with slight trepidation that I headed north. Don't get me wrong, I love Cocoa Beach; I just detest tourist traps, and the place is littered with them.
Upon entering the Sunset Care Waterfront Grill & Bar, I paused as my eyes took in the scene. I glanced at my watch to make sure it wasn't the 3:30 geriatric dinner crowd as at 58; I was the youngest human in here by a decade. It wasn't that early, but it wasn't late either...is this how it begins?
Tamara was my server for the meal and while she started out with a bang, she ended with a whimper. The charm was there, as well as the skill, maybe the desire checked out half-way through my meal. I asked Tamara for an order of the Sunset Seafood Combo along with some Fries.
Taking in the atmosphere along with the view, I wondered what it was about a great view and average food. Is the rent on the location so high that it affects the ability to procure quality ingredients? Or maybe the owner thinks that the view will obscure all else and is trying to make as much off of each patron as possible? I don't have any answers, all I know is experience and experience suggests one of those, at the very least, must be true.
If you take a moment to toss your peepers at the accompanying pictures, you will see that everything certainly looked good, if not delicious. The Sunset Seafood Combo consisted of a filet of grouper, shrimp, and a crab cake grilled or blackened served with your choice of sweet potato fries, French fries, or rice pilaf and homemade slaw. As one can tell, I went with the blackened.
Nothing was ocean fresh, or even close to it, but everything was seasoned well. I found the shrimp to be above what one normally finds in a joint like this; the grouper and crab cake were not.
The Big Boy says, "better than most places with a view, but still average." read more
